Bank of Baroda reported its highest-ever quarterly net profit of Rs. 5,616 crores for Q4 FY26, up 11.2% YoY, with full-year net profit crossing Rs. 20,000 crores for the first time. Global business crossed Rs. 30 lakh crores milestone with 13.9% YoY growth. Advances grew 16.2% (domestic 14.5%, international 24.4%) while deposits grew 12%. The bank upgraded its loan growth guidance from 11-13% to 12-14% and deposit growth from 9-11% to 10-12%. NIM improved 10 bps sequentially to 2.89%. Asset quality remains robust with GNPA at 1.89% and Net NPA below 1% at 0.45%. The bank created a Rs. 1,500 crore floating provision from IT refunds to strengthen balance sheet. New initiatives include a pension fund subsidiary (6-9 months timeline), operational PD subsidiary from April 1, 2026, and plans to raise Rs. 6,000 crore via AT-1/Tier-2 bonds. The bank also launched a green infrastructure bond of Rs. 10,000 crore.
Strong Q4 and FY26 results with record profits demonstrate the bank's consistent performance (ROA above 1% for 15 consecutive quarters). The upward revision in growth guidance signals management confidence in maintaining momentum despite geopolitical headwinds. The Rs. 1,500 crore floating provision provides additional buffer against potential asset quality deterioration from West Asia conflict impact on MSME and overseas operations.
